Over the last few decades, there has been a continuing trend toward replacing hydraulically powered equipment on work trucks and other commercial vehicles with electrically powered equipment. This technology shift is the result of a variety of factors, including the need for fuel efficiency and a desire for lighter, more compact vehicle systems.

Switching to electrically powered equipment offers one way for truck builders to reduce weight and minimize the amount of space a system takes up. The growing shift from hydraulics to electricity makes it more important than ever to control the distribution of electrical power effectively.
